Molecular gas plays an important role in the structure of planetary nebulae: it is a major component of the equatorial tori of bipolar nebulae, it forms the cores of globules and related mircostructures, and is the likely origin of multiple arcs. It is also a key component during the early stages of formation where interactions with outflows or jets provide an important shaping mechanism.
